Product Introduction

The HM-F8 is an 8-channel automatic micro dispensing station built for laboratories whose daily workload is plate-based: 96-well ELISA plates, PCR plates, and deep-well culture plates. Its DG-8 pump head fills an entire 96-well plate in one programmed cycle — up to 8 wells per pass — delivering ≤10 μL accuracy at the 50 μL reference point and holding errors within 2% above 200 μL. The working range spans a 20 μL minimum to 9,999,999 μL in quantitative mode, with unlimited-volume constant-flow for bulk reagent bottling. Because peristaltic dispensing is non-contact, liquid touches only replaceable platinum-cured silicone tubing (OD 3 mm × ID 1 mm, rated -51 to 238°C), so cross-contamination between wells, reagents, and batches is structurally eliminated. The 7-inch touchscreen stores 10 programmable recipes with up to 32 column volumes each, while the 15 mm maximum needle spacing and adjustable rack height accommodate plates, tube strips, and flasks. Calibrated to JJF (Ji) 233-2024 and JJF 1259-2018, the HM-F8 fits a 355 × 280 × 550 mm benchtop footprint and runs quieter than 60 dB.

Functional Performance

  1. 8-channel DG-8 pump head — parallel dispensing completes a 96-well plate in 12 passes at up to 600 rpm.

  2. ≤10 μL accuracy at 50 μL — consistent parallel delivery across all eight channels, ≤2% error above 200 μL.

  3. Non-contact fluid path — liquid contacts only platinum-cured silicone tubing rated -51 to 238°C; no internal path to clean.

  4. Whole-plate and any-column strategies — fill an entire plate or only the columns an assay needs.

  5. Dual dispensing modes — quantitative (manual or programmed, up to 9,999,999 μL) and unlimited-volume constant-flow.

  6. 10 programmable recipes — 32 column volumes per recipe, recalled in two taps on the 7-inch touchscreen.

  7. Adjustable dispensing strength — multi-level flow control for viscous reagents or fragile cell suspensions.

  8. 15 mm maximum needle spacing — fits standard microplates, tube strips, and small vessels.

  9. Back-suction recovery — returns unused reagent from tubing to the source container after each run.

  10. Rinsing and mixing functions — priming, washing, and homogenizing without extra accessories.

  11. Verifiable calibration — JJF (Ji) 233-2024 and JJF 1259-2018 compliance, re-verifiable by the ISO 8655 gravimetric method.
